AI Technical Summary
Technical Problem
Existing FGFR4 inhibitors suffer from insufficient selectivity and significant side effects when treating cancer, especially liver cancer, leading to off-target effects and toxicity.
Method used
The compound of formula (I) is used in combination with CDK inhibitors, lenvatinib or sorafenib to form a drug combination, which improves efficacy and reduces side effects through low-dose administration.
Benefits of technology
It significantly improved the treatment effect on cancer, especially liver cancer, while reducing drug side effects and improving the safety of medication.

Abstract
A pharmaceutical combination and pharmaceutical composition comprising a compound of Formula (I) or a pharmaceutically acceptable form thereof and at least one other anticancer agent, and the use thereof in the manufacture of a medicament for the treatment of a malignant neoplastic disease. Wherein the other anticancer agent is a CDK inhibitor or a pharmaceutically acceptable salt thereof (such as ribociclib), lenvatinib or a pharmaceutically acceptable salt thereof, sorafenib or a pharmaceutically acceptable salt thereof, or any combination of the foregoing.
